Game 88: Mets at Braves
(UPDATED: 5:55 P.M.) ATLANTA — The Mets open the second half here tonight hoping to pick up where they left off when Oliver Perez takes on the Braves at Turner Field.
When we last left Jerry Manuel‘s club, they were rebounding from a miserable stretch to win the final two games of a home series with the Reds and enter the All-Star break on a high note.
But to keep the good feelings going, the Amazin’s will have to hope Perez can outduel Braves ace Derek Lowe in a matchup of offseason Omar Minaya free-agent targets. Minaya settled on Perez after Lowe turned down the Mets in favor of Atlanta’s $60 million offer. Perez, who is making just his second start since coming off the disabled list, is 6-4 with a 3.46 ERA in 14 career starts against the Braves. Conversely, Lowe is 2-2 with a 6.75 ERA in nine career appearances against the Mets.
